2,147,521,488 is a composite number, even.
2,147,521,488 (two billion one hundred forty-seven million five hundred twenty-one thousand four hundred eighty-eight) is an even 10-digit number. It is a composite number with 160 divisors, and factors as 2⁴ × 3 × 7 × 109 × 191 × 307. Its proper divisors sum to 4,305,398,832, more than the number itself, making it an abundant number. Written other ways, in hexadecimal, 0x800093D0.
